Meaning of Equity

The quality of being fair and impartial.

In simple words: Fairness or equal treatment

Equity in a sentence

  • The company aims to promote gender equity in the workplace.
  • Equity is essential for a just society.
  • Investors are concerned about the equity of their shares.

How to use Equity

Used in legal, financial, and social contexts to indicate fairness. May not be appropriate in casual conversations.
